Polymer Resin Market size was valued at USD 731.08 Billion in 2024 and is poised to grow from USD 772.02 Billion in 2025 to USD 1193.82 Billion by 2033, growing at a CAGR of 5.6% during the forecast period (2026-2033).
Polymer resin represents a technological alternative to natural herbal products, beginning as a stable, viscous liquid upon exposure to air. The primary raw materials for polymer resin production include hydrocarbon fuels such as natural gas, crude oil, coal, salt, and sand. The polymer resin industry comprises two key components: manufacturers converting intermediates into resins and processors creating end products. Monomer producers utilize various polymerization processes to synthesize resins, driving the market forward. Crude polymeric outputs are frequently available as liquid adhesives, coatings, or in bulk forms such as pellets, powders, granules, and sheets. To manufacture these materials, producers typically employ cracking techniques to transform petroleum hydrocarbons into essential polymeric alkenes, including ethylene, propylene, and butylene, facilitating diverse applications.

Restraints in the Polymer Resin Market
The Polymer Resin market faces significant challenges, primarily due to the volatility in crude oil prices, which directly impacts resin pricing. As most plastic resin petrochemical feedstocks originate as by-products of oil and natural gas extraction, fluctuations in oil prices-driven by factors such as supply and demand dynamics, natural disasters, and changes in production costs-have a cascading effect on resin costs. This unpredictability poses considerable risks to market growth. Additionally, stringent environmental regulations aimed at curbing plastic usage further hinder market advancement, as over 99% of plastics are derived from oil, natural gas, and coal, which contribute to pollution and negatively impact ecosystems and public health.
Market Trends of the Polymer Resin Market
The Polymer Resin market is witnessing a significant shift towards bio-based polymer resins, driven by rising environmental consciousness and a collective push for sustainable packaging solutions. As traditional petroleum-based plastics face scrutiny for their detrimental ecological impacts and contribution to plastic pollution, bio-based alternatives are gaining popularity among consumers, industries, and regulatory bodies. This trend is propelled by the recognition of the urgent need for sustainable materials that mitigate the adverse effects of plastic waste. Key factors fueling this transition include governmental incentives, advancements in manufacturing technologies, and heightened awareness of the ecological footprint associated with conventional plastics, signaling a transformative move towards a more sustainable future in packaging.
